The question reflects broader trends in driver education and lifestyle flexibility. With economic pressures, shared mobility, and tech-driven car access, many young drivers rely on rental vehicles to gain real-world experience without ownership costs. Social media discussions, parent forums, and teen driver guides highlight this shift, showing a quiet but growing interest in how vehicles—especially rented ones—fit into licensing success.
